Movie Overview and Plot
Poison Ivy: The New Seduction (1997) is the third installment in the Poison Ivy erotic thriller franchise. Directed by Kurt Voss, the film attempts to replicate the formula of the 1992 original by blending themes of psychological manipulation, class envy, and the "femme fatale" archetype. While it leans heavily into the tropes of the late-90s direct-to-video market, it serves as a fascinating look at the era's obsession with the "vixen" character.
